SUPPLEMENTAL RESTRAINT SYSTEM: CURTAIN SHIELD AIRBAG ASSEMBLY:

INSTALLATION

1. INSTALL CURTAIN SHIELD AIRBAG ASSEMBLY
(a) Check that the ignition switch is in the OFF position.
(b) Check that the cable is connected to the negative (-) battery terminal is disconnected.

CAUTION: Work must be started at least 90 seconds after the ignition switch is turned off and after the cable is disconnected from the negative (-) battery terminal.

(c) Connect the connector to the curtain shield airbag assembly.

NOTE: When handling the airbag connector, take care not to damage the airbag wire harness.

(d) Install the curtain shield airbag assembly with the 9 bolts in the order shown in the illustration.





Torque: 9.8 Nm (100 kgf-cm, 87 in-lbf)

NOTE: Do not twist the curtain shield airbag assembly when installing it.

2. INSPECT CURTAIN SHIELD AIRBAG ASSEMBLY (Curtain Shield Airbag Assembly)

3. INSTALL ROOF HEADLINING ASSEMBLY

HINT: Refer to the procedures up to "INSTALL ROOF HEADLINING ASSEMBLY" (Installation).

4. CONNECT CABLE TO NEGATIVE BATTERY TERMINAL
5. PERFORM INITIALIZATION
(a) Perform initialization (Repair Instruction - Initialization).

HINT: Some systems need initialization after reconnecting the cable to the negative battery terminal.

6. INSPECT SRS WARNING LIGHT
(a) Inspect the SRS warning light (Diagnosis System).
